Cavendishia complectens is a type of shrub that is typically found in the neotropics, a region in the Americas. It is known for its ability to grow as an epiphyte, meaning it can thrive by attaching itself to other plants or structures. This unique characteristic makes it a popular plant among gardeners and nature enthusiasts.
